logo

Output cdb7c621b81066849c89e924a67d320f3b55e11b155a271f13c949e96130c251:1

value
24160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c705a572154210dff191274946ec5aa66e6d33 OP_EQUAL
address
34gKxydWaPyBMj6Nm32h5m44mzUozi8czN
transaction
cdb7c621b81066849c89e924a67d320f3b55e11b155a271f13c949e96130c251